However, there is a limit to the times that one can push his finances to the
edges. Accumulating a huge mound of debts every time to be cleared through a
debt consolidation loan will be unwise. When the debt consolidation loan has
been secured on ones home or certain moveable or immoveable assets, the stake is
directly on the asset pledged. Incapability to repay loan instalments will
result into repossession of the asset. Even when the debt consolidation loan is
unsecured, lender has the right to recover the amount unpaid through court
proceedings.
Another argument for a judicious use of debt consolidation loans is that the
equity in home so consumed could have been used for other important purposes.
Equity in the home makes the borrower eligible for better deals in whatever loan
that he approaches for. Having consumed the whole equity will force the borrower
to accept deals at par with the non-homeowners or at comparatively higher rates
of interest.

Like in any financial matter, the structure of the debt consolidation loan
should be decided with prudence. By the structure of the loan is meant the terms
on which the loan is taken. This includes the rate of interest, amount of
monthly instalment, prepayment facility, etc. Do not hesitate in questioning the
terms that you find unjustifiable. Take independent advice if necessary from
independent financial advisors. This would be helpful because they have a
specialised knowledge of the field. The independent financial advisors provide
guidance on important matters related to the loan. Many easy to use softwares
like debt consolidation loan calculator have also come up to help borrowers in
the decision making process.
